This could be the kind of peaceful waterfront Keys property that actually pays you back. Located in one of the Upper Keys' most beloved neighborhoods locally known as 'Indian Mound' this canal-front duplex blends Old Florida charm with solid construction and real future potential. Water access is a big deal in the Keys, and it's excellent here. With 32' of dockage on a 100' wide turning basin, you'll have quick, easy access to the bay. Tavernier Creek is just around the corner, making ocean runs simple. Built in 1959, the concrete two-unit home features terrazzo floors and unique accent walls that give it that classic Old Florida feel. Each unit offers 2 bedrooms and 1 bath. Both are leased month-to-month to long-term tenants. The home is protected by a 5V-crimp Galvalume metal roof and cooled by two 2019 A/C systems. It sits on an oversized 10,000 sq ft lot with mature trees and buried power lines. Recognized as a duplex by the Village of Islamorada, this property offers compelling redevelopment options. An owner could convert the duplex into a single-family home, creating a valuable market-rate waterfront Transferable Development Right (TDR) to sell. Or, continue operating the duplex as a solid income-producing property in a quiet, highly desirable neighborhood. Old Florida character, dependable income, and flexibility for the future - this is a smart fit for someone who values both lifestyle and return. Vacant 7,023 sq ft lot next door is available separately.
